The UFC on ESPN fight card, to no one’s surprise, saw many long term layoffs. Some of them simply because the fights they had were tough, and others because of the severe damage sustained by the fighters. The complete results of medical suspension for the UFC card are below (credit to MMA Fighting)

UFC on ESPN 12 medical suspension list

Dustin Poirier: Suspended until Aug. 27, no contact until Aug. 12 (tough fight)Dan Hooker: Suspended until Aug. 27, no contact until Aug. 12 (tough fight)Mike Perry: Suspended until July 28, no contact until July 19 (left eyebrow lacerations, suspension can be lifted by a physician)Mickey Gall: Suspended until July 28, no contact until July 19Maurice Greene: Suspended until Aug. 12, no contact until July 28 (left cheek laceration)Gian Villante: Suspended until Dec. 25 pending X-rays and clearance from an orthopedic doctor (left hand), minimum suspension until Aug. 12, no contact until July 28Brendan Allen: Suspended until Dec. 25 pending clearance from ENT doctor (orbital, nasal, and sinus fractures), minimum suspension until Aug. 12, no contact until July 28Kyle Daukaus: Suspended until Aug. 27, no contact until Aug. 12 (eyebrow laceration)Philipe Lins: Suspended until Aug. 27, no contact until Aug. 12Julian Erosa: Suspended until Aug. 12, no contact until July 28 (left eye laceration)Sean Woodson: Suspended until July 28, no contact until July 19Khama Worthy: Suspended until Dec. 25 pending X-rays (right ankle), MRI (left knee), and clearance from an orthopedic doctorLuis Pena: Suspended until July 28, no contact until July 19Jason Witt: Suspended until Aug. 12, no contact until July 28Kay Hansen: Suspended until Aug. 12, no contact until July 28 (left eye laceration, suspension can be lifted by a physician)
